Definition of affinal - Reverso English Dictionary
Adjective
anthropologyTECH. related by marriage, not by bloodTECH.
- In many cultures, affinal ties are crucial for alliances.
- Affinal relationships can influence family decisions.
- The study focused on affinal connections in tribal societies.
Origin of affinal
Latin, affinis (related)
